I remember deleting 2 of my 4 beta characters right before they were removed so I tried checking the names of those I deleted myself vs. the names of the ones I didn’t. The names of the characters that I deleted worked and were available. The names of the ones that I let sit there until they were removed are definitely still unavailable.

That is not a bug.
Influence is accrued and spent separately by the guild members on each world. For example, a guild with players in Maguuma, Blacktide, and Riverside will have three different pools of Influence and three different build queues, one for each world.
